#143ff3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#143ff3 is composed of 7.8% red, 24.7%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.8% cyan, 74.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 228.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 51.6%. #143ff3 color hex could be obtained by blending #287eff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#143ff3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000208 is the darkest color, while #f4f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#143ff3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7f8b is the less saturated color, while #0b39fd is the most saturated one.
